采用进口 5 3 5 6焊丝对国产 60 0 5A铝合金进行熔化极惰性气体保护焊 ,对焊接接头的力学性能和显微组织进行了研究 .结果表明 ,60 0 5A铝合金焊接接头的力学性能低于基体的性能 ,热影响区内的软化区是焊接接头的最薄弱环节 。
Domestic 6005A alloy was welded using imported 5356 solder wire with method of MIG. Mechanical properties and microstructures of welded joint were studied. The results show that mechanical properties of 6005A welded joint is worse than that of base metal, the soften zone in heat-affected zone (HAZ) is the weakest point of welded joint, which is formed due to the overaging of the main strengthening phase particle leading to coarsening.
